Allama Ibtisam Elahi Zaheer

Ibtisam Elahi Zaheer was born on 19 August `1971 and he is son of renowned scholar Allama Ehsan Elahi Zaheer who was founder of Jamiat Ahle Hadith Pakistan. Ibtisam Elahi Zaheer got his primary education from Cresescent Model School and passed his matriculation from there .He than entered Government college Lahore and Passed his pre engineering college exams from there.He than entered famous Engineering university of Lahore.During his graduation he memorised the Holy Quran and after graduating from Engineering university he did masters in 11 subjects which is a record in academic history of Pakistan

Nadeem Sarwar


Nadeem Sarwar is a son of (Late) Syed Asrar Hussain Rizvi and Syeda Nargis Khatoon of Karachi, Pakistan.
Married, with three children, Nadeem Sarwar lives in Karachi, Pakistan.
He started Nauha Khwaani at the age of four years old and his first teacher for reciting was his mother anddedicated himself to Nauha Khwaani at the age of eight.
Nadeem Sarwar has recited in different languages such as Urdu, Sindhi, Sariki, Punjabi, Pushto, Pourbi, Hindi, Gujarati, Persian, Arabic, English, and French.
Nadeem Sarwar has recited Nauha in many different ways of Matam like Persian Matam, Arabic Matam, Quetta Matam, Parachanar Matam, Afghan Matam, Sariki matam, Punjabi Matam, Sindhi Matam, Hyderabad Dakkan Matam and Khoja Shia Ithna Asheri Saf Matam.
Nadeem Sarwar has recited a total of 179 Kalaam up to date. These Marsias and Nauhas are very popular especially for children. Nadeem Sarwar has recited these Marsias and Nauhas from great writers of Islam, such as,

Dr Gholam Mujtaba

Dr. Gholam Mujtaba, is a prominent politician of urban Sindh in Pakistan . He served as Advisor to Chief Minister Sindh, Pakistan (1992-94).He was the leader of the coalition party to the Sindh Government from 1992-94 . Dr. Mujtaba was a prominent student leader of Pakistan (1976-78). He was elected General Secretary of the Karachi University Students Union in 1976, and served as a member of the University Senate and Syndicate in 1976-78.He played a leading role in the Pakistan National Alliance Movement of 1977-78 as a student leader.
He was a close associate of the former President Pervez Musharraf during his last days in power. He had succeeded in striking a deal between the opposition and the President, but failed to dispense the covert under wrap.
Dr.Mujtaba is prominent amongst Pakistanis in the U.S. politics. He is a Member of the Chairman's Advisory Board of the Republican Party, the Republican National Committee of the United States. He is the Director of he Corona-Elmhurst Center for Economic Development where US Senator Charles Schumer and Assemblyman Jose Peralta are advisors and sponsors of the Center.
Professor Mujtaba is named to the United Who's Who Registry as an Honored Member. He is a distinguished alumni of King's College London, US Army Academy of Health Sciences, Fort Sam, Texas, the University of Karachi and Rajshahi Cadet College.

Qazi Hussain Ahmed

Qazi Hussain Ahmed was third elected Ameer, Jamaat-e-Islami of Pakistan, after its fouder-Ameer Syed Abu ul Ala Maudoodi and his successor Mian Tufail Muhammad. He was born in 1938 in Village Ziarat Kaka Kheil Sahib District Noshera NWFP, his father Molana Qazi Abdul Rab, was a distinguished Theologian and partly because of his Scholarship, and partly because of his political insight he was elected President the then Jamiat Ulama-e-Hind NWFP.
He is the youngest amongst his ten siblings. His two elder brothers namely Dr. Attique-ul- Rehman and late Qazi Atta ur Rehman had been workers of Islami jamiat-e-Talaba(A sister orgainzation of Jamaat-e-Islami Pakistan). Qazi Hussain Ahmed followed the suit and started participating in the activities of jamiat. He studied Jamiat Literature and imbibed the spirit thereof, and then dedicated the rest of his life for the cause of Islam.
Earlier Education and Practical Life
Qazi Hussain Ahmed received his earlier education from his learned father at home, then having passed his graduation from Islamia College Peshawar. He earned his M.Sc in Geography from University of Peshawar, whereafter, he taught as Lecturer in Jahanzeb College Saidu Sharif for three years. Due to political activities, and his natural bend for the same he had to discontinue his service, so he resigned. Thereafter, he started his own business at Peshawar, there too, he made his name known and was elected as Vice President of the Chamber of Commerce and Industry NWFP.
Political Life
His introduction with Islami Jamiat Talba during his student life, whipped up his zeal to work in the vanguard of Islamic movement. Therefore, he acquired the membership of jamaat Islami and went on to head the Organization in Peshawar City, then District Peshawar and thereafter the President ship of the NWFP Chapter of the party fell to his lot.
In 1978 he was appointed as Secretary General of Jamaat-e-Islami Pakistan, in 1987 he became Ameer-e-Jamaat (president of the Party), and since then has served as such, for four terms in a row.Qazi Hussain Ahmed was elected to the Senate of Pakistan in 1985, and again elected Senator in 1992, but this time in protest to the Government Policies, he resigned as senator.
It is worth mentioning that he won the election as a member of National Assembly from two constituencies in the general election held in the year 2002 .
UNITY OF UMMAH----- The first priority
Qazi Hussain Ahmed has always taken pride as a follower of Prophet Muhammad (Peace be upon him) and therefore unity of the followers of the Prophet of Islam has always been his chief concern and to get this objective, he has striven hard to forge unity amongst various factions of Islamic Parities and that especially of the components of MMA Alliance (Muthida Majlas-e-Amal) was materialization of his dream. Due to his selflessness, he was unanimously elected President of the Alliance after the sad demise, of Maulana Shah Ahmed Noorani. Earlier, when the fire of hatred of dissent and division between Shias and Sunnies, was flame, he formed National solidarity council (Milli Yakjehti Council) which effectively extinguished the sectarian fire. Thereafter he was instrumental in the formation of IJI (Islami Jamhoori Ittehad) an alliance of right wing of political Parties.
When lingual bias in Karachi was enflamed Qazi Sahib led a procession of brotherhood love and peace (Karwan-e- Dawat-o- Muhabbat), all the way from Peshawar to Karachi and back which enkindled the candle of love throughout country in general, and peace was restored in Karachi, in particular. It may be recalled that he dauntlessly, led Tahrik-e-Nazam-e-Mustafa(Enforcement of Sharia) in the province of NWFP as its provincial chief and bore the brunt of imprisonment. His efforts to bring about unity among Ummah were not confined to the territories of Pakistan alone, rather, they were world wide in scope and nature.
When Mujahideen battling the then USSR, fell apart, Qazi Hussain Ahmed collected notables and leaders from around the Muslim world, to iron out the differences among various Afghan Mujahideen Groups, unfortunately, the enemy neutralized all such efforts. Again seeds of dissent were sown among Muslim Freedom Fighters in Kashmir; he again brought them together and dispelled the misgivings in time. When Doctor Hasan Turabi Founder Of Islamic Movement in Sudan, and General Umar Hasan Al Bashir the Head Of the State, stood estranged, both the parties referred the matter to the Qazi Sahib for arbitration which resulted in peace between the parties. But the International and regional conspiracies frustrated peace efforts, notwithstanding, he let not the differences turn into a clash.
Be it, Iraq, Kuwait or issue of Palestine, Qazi Hussain Ahmed was not less concerned. Plight of the Muslims in Bosnia ,Kosovo and Chechnia, agonized him beyond description, last but not least repression of the Muslims in Burma and Eriteria equally pained him, therefore he tried his best to find out a just solution to the aforementioned problems under the aegis of united forum Of Muslim Ummah.
Qazi Sahib and Extention Of Propogation
Right after assuming the leadership of Jamaat-e-Islami Pakistan, Qazi Hussain Ahmed paid special attention to the propagation of the manifesto of the Party by taking out countrywide processions, extending invitation to study the program of the party to the notables from every walk of life and in this connection, he formed various National Committees, a hectic membership campaign was launched throughout country , as a result thereof, over 4.5 million of people, espoused the cause of Jamaat-e-Islami.
Arrests and Imprisonments
Qazi Hussain Ahmed was arrested on many a occasion for his commitment to the cause of his party. He was first arrested during Tahrik-e-Nizam-e-Mustafa in 1977 again he was imprisoned when he took out a protest procession against American aggression in Afghanistan. Once more he protested over publication of blasphemous cartoons of the Prophet (PBUH) in Danish Paper, thus he was jailed during his detention, he penned down number of articles which were later published in a book form, which are eight in number.
Family Life
Qazi Hussain Ahmed is married with two sons and two daughters. His wife and children all are Jamaat-e- Islami activists. He is lodging up in a two bed room flat which speaks volumes of the facts that how simple a life he leads like any party worker. He has full command over Urdu,English , Arabic and Persian a part from his native tongue Pushto. He is great admirer of the poet of Islam. Allama Muhammad Iqbal and quotes if from his both Urdu and Persian poetry, at will, in his speeches and conversations.

Tasleem Ahmad Sabri

Sahibzada Tasleem Ahmad Sabri opened his eyes to a devout Muslim family living in Karachi. He was greatly influenced in his childhood and early youth by the enormous and virtuous saint of the Qadria and Chishtia Schools of Sophia, Syed Muhammad Abdullah Shah (Mian Jee), whose humbleness and piety left a lasting impression on Tasleem and taught him the base virtues of the religion that he would devote his life to. Mian Jee passed away in 1989 and was laid down to rest in an elegantly built shrine in Korangi. Tasleem Sabri’s father, Muhammad Adil Sabri is the Sajjadah Nasheen in succession and custodian of the Shrine.

Sahibzada Tasleem Ahmad Sabri had natural talent for speech from childhood and contested in scores of programs and competitions during school and college life during which he won numerous awards and trophies. At the same time, he stayed true to his family legacy of spirituality and developed an intense interest in Na’at and the study of Seerat-e-Rasool (SAW). He completed his Graduation & Post Graduation in Accounting and Finance, and also served in the Accounts & Finance Department of a well-reputed organization in Karachi for few years.

From the early 90’s however, he started taking a more active interest in hosting Na’at and Seerat programs in public gatherings, and afterwards on PTV. Later on, he joined the ARY Digital Group, the largest media group in Pakistan, when their Islamic Channel, QTV started in the end of 2004. Sahibzada Tasleem Ahmad Sabri was the first person to appear onscreen. Within a very short span of this appearance, he established himself as one of the most beloved and admired anchors and hosts for Islamic Talk Shows and Na’at programs in the world.

Sehri Time transmissions with Tasleem Sabri is widely known to be one of the most popular Islamic programs broadcast on QTV during the month of Ramzan ul Mubarak every year- Tasleem Sabri’s hosting and conversation has captured the hearts of millions of Muslims from around the world.. QTime is another unique program in which he interviews many celebrities about their personal lives, religious interests, and activities. Occasionally, he hosts in Na’at and Seerat programs on QTV in his particular, distinctive style which has made him an icon amongst viewers from around the globe- and indeed he is often invited to host such events all over the world.

He released two CDs (Tasleemat and Tasleem-o-Raza) in 2007-2008 in which he, for the first time in the history of na’at, recited na’ats in his own poetic, declamatory style (Teht-ul-Lafz)- an something that was a completely new innovation and unheard of at the time, but which has now inspired many people.

Tasleem Ahmed Sabri also has the distinction of being one of the very few people to have recorded the entire Holy Qur’an in audio form. This recording was played on QTV during the month of Ramzan in which the voice narrating the Urdu translation was taken from this work.

Tasleem Sabri is a person of many interests- his hobbies include playing cricket and reading books. He is a well read person, and remembers thousands of poems and stanzas by heart and shares these with the public, which are one of the hallmarks of his particular, literary style of oratory. Sahibzada Tasleem Ahmad Sabri has a pleasant and witty personality with a good sense of humor, enjoyed by his family and close circle of friends- he is deemed to be as endearing personally as he is as a TV personality.

Haji Hanif Tayyab

Mr. Hanif Tayyab was educated in Madrasatul Islam Kharader and did his matriculation from Qureshi High School. He got admitted to D.J. Science College but later opted for arts and got Masters degree in Islamic Studies from Karachi University. He also received LL.B. degree from Urdu Law College, but he did not go for the legal profession. He preferred the field of social service and politics. He established Anjuman-e-Tulba-e-Islam and served as its Founder President. He also worked with Maulana Abdul Sattar Edhi for sometimes. He then joined Jamiat-e-Ulemai Pakistan and served as General Secretary of the Karachi branch. In 1975, he was elected as a member of the National Assembly. In 1977, he was again elected to the National Assembly. In 1983, he was elected on the seat reserved for Karachi Municipal Corporation.

He was elected member of the National Assembly in the non-party elections held in 1985. In 1985, he became Federal Minister. His portfolios were changed from time to time but he continued as a minister. He remained Federal Minister for more than 3 years and got varied experience of Ministry for Labour, Manpower & Overseas Pakistanis, National Resources, Environment etc. He took part in a number of international conferences and traveled to Indonesia, Kenya, India, Iran, Saudi Arabia, UK, USA, Iraq & Holland etc. For 5 times he was elected President of All Pakistan Memon Federation. He rendered his social services under the banner of Al-Mustafa Welfare Trust to the people of Pakistan.
